Reigning Abu Dhabi HSBC Championship winner Shane Lowry is tied for the lead at the halfway stage of The Open Championship.
The Irishman is on eight under par along with America's JB Holmes after two rounds at Royal Portrush.
The duo are a shot ahead of Tommy Fleetwood and Lee Westwood.
Meanwhile Tiger Woods, Rory McIlroy, and Phil Mickelson all missed the cut.
